WebCommits and their parents. A branch in Git is simply a lightweight movable pointer to one of these commits. The default branch name in Git is master . As you start making commits, you’re given a master branch that points to the last commit you made. Every time you commit, the master branch pointer moves forward automatically. Git merge and Git rebase integrate commits from a source branch into your current local branch (target branch). Git merge performs either a fast-forward or a no-fast-forward merge. The no-fast-forward merge is also known as a three-way merge or true merge. Git rebaseis another type of merge. WebSpecifying -b causes a new branch to be created as if git-branch [1] were called and then checked out. In this case you can use the --track or --no-track options, which will be passed to git branch. As a convenience, --track without -b implies branch creation; see the description of --track below.
